USGS Earthquakes Real TimeThe most recent information on earthquakes is available at the U.S. Geological Survey. The data maps are updated within 5 minutes of an earthquake and once an hour. The magnitude is also determined in 4-5 minutes. The maps will also show you the fault lines. You can also get real time shaking maps and real time forecasts of California for the next 24 hours. You may also want to see the real time seismogram displays, network report, and updates. If you live in Northern California, you may wish to get on the email notification list of Northern California Earthquakes.
